データベースを分割すると、データベースを2つのファイルに再編成することになります。 1つのファイルは、データとテーブルを含むバックエンドデータベースです。もう1つのファイルは、クエリ、フォーム、およびレポートを含むフロントエンドデータベースです。ユーザーは、フロントエンドデータベースのローカルコピーを使用してデータを操作します。
Microsoft Accessでは、データベーススプリッタウィザードを使用してデータベースを分割できます。これが、Accessが大好きな多くの理由の1つです。これにより、このようなタスクをすばやく簡単に完了することができます。データベースを分割したら、フロントエンドデータベースをユーザーに配布する必要があります。
データベースを分割する理由と、分割することのメリットについて詳しく見ていきましょう。
データベースの分割を検討する必要があるのはなぜですか?
すべてのデータベースを分割する必要はありませんが、アーキテクチャの観点から検討する必要があります。データベースをフロントエンドとバックエンドに分割することで、データベースのパフォーマンスを向上させ、破損のリスクを減らし、さらにはコストを節約することができます。
Accessデータベースを分割すると、2つのファイルが作成されます。バックエンドデータベースにはテーブルのみが含まれ、フロントエンドにはクエリ、フォーム、マクロ、レポート、モジュールなどすべてが含まれます。これらはすべて、テーブルへのアクセスを許可せずにユーザーに配布できます。
また、データベーススプリッタウィザードを使用すると、データベースの分割は一般的に非常に簡単です。ただし、大規模またはより複雑なデータベースを分割する場合は、最初にArkwareなどのデータベースの専門家に相談することをお勧めします。
アクセスデータベースを分割する利点は何ですか?
データベースを分割することには多くの利点があります:
- パフォーマンスの向上。 分割データベースでは、データのみがネットワークを介して送信されるため、パフォーマンスが大幅に向上しました。分割されていないデータベースでは、データだけでなく、すべてのデータベースオブジェクトもネットワーク経由で送信する必要があります。
- セキュリティの強化。 ユーザーはテーブルに直接アクセスできないため、誤ってテーブルを削除したり、データを盗んだりするリスクが少なくなります。フロントエンドユーザーがアプリケーションに変更を加えることを制限することもできます。
- 信頼性の向上。 Accessデータベースを分割すると、データベースが破損するリスクが軽減されます。個々のユーザーに問題がある場合、それは通常、データベース全体ではなく、そのユーザーに関連しています。
- 強化された柔軟性。 各ユーザーはフロントエンドデータベースのローカルコピーを操作するため、ユーザーは他のユーザーに影響を与えることなく、クエリ、フォーム、およびその他のデータベースオブジェクトを作成できます。
Arkwareに連絡してデータベースを分割する
データベース分割はデータベースに適していると思いますか?相談についてはArkwareにお問い合わせください。小さくて合理化されたデータベースがある場合は、データベーススプリッタウィザードを使用してデータベースを自分で分割できる可能性があります。より複雑なデータベースは私たちの助けから恩恵を受けることができます!